Finance Review Summary — Warranty Overrun, Halvern Tools

Quick recap for department heads: warranty costs on the Rexfield drill series came in about 40% over budget, mostly down to a batch of faulty motor housings. We've booked an extra reserve and paused shipments from the affected line. Supplier talks start next week. How this shapes our broader plans is covered in the confidential note below.

internal memo for kawip-hadug: Headcount on the Wenwyn team goes from 7 to 140 by the end of January. Gross margin on Wenwyn came in at 20 percent against a plan of 15 percent.

Leadership Briefing — the new "Skylark" Tier

Welcome aboard. Quick context: Skylark is our mid-price subscription tier, soft-launched in the Bryn Vale region last month. Uptake is ahead of plan, support tickets are manageable, and upgrade friction is low. Pricing review lands next sprint. The confidential note below explains where Skylark fits in next year's plan.

management briefing: Gross margin on Ralwyn came in at 5 percent against a plan of 5 percent. Only 3 of the 120 pilot accounts renewed Ralwyn, so a churn review is set for January 1.

**Checklist item 7: Consent banner rollout**

Before flipping the Dovetrail consent banner to 100%, double-check that the dismissal state persists across sessions and that the banner doesn't reappear after locale switches — that bit us last quarter. Keep the rollout flag at 25% for at least a day and watch the opt-out rate dashboard. If anything looks weird, roll back, don't patch forward. Note for posterity: the canary build we validated is recorded just below.

build token for kagaf-hahof: htk14_9d3d4d26d7d8de